Today we said goodbye to Joey.
He has been sick and on medication for a heart condition for a long time, and his overall quality of life has really suffered, especially the past couple of weeks.
I will always remember the moment I saw him for the first time. All the dogs at the SPCA were barking and going crazy except for him. Joey was just smiling at me. Although I was there "just to look," I adopted him immediately. Then I took him home and he ran in circles around my apartment and showed me that he knew how to bark after all.
One day I came home from work and Joey had taken the pillows off my couch and torn them to pieces. Turns out the pillows were filled with down, and my floor was entirely covered in feathers. In his puppy phase, Joey also destroyed countless shoes, belts, books and furniture. But in my single life he was my faithful friend to whom I would come home after long days of work and bad dates. He would always be happy to see me, wagging his tail and smiling. I swear, my dog knew how to smile.
When I got married, after they got over a rocky start, Joey and Matt had a special relationship. Matt would take him for long walks at the park, and I think those were Joey's favorite times. Joey had the utmost respect for Matt and would follow him around the house and lay under his chair while Matt worked. For hours, Joey would wait patiently at the window for Matt to come home, and he would whimper and bark with excitement when Matt's car pulled up to the house.
Joey loved to give kisses to Larkin and Layne, and he would lick their faces endlessly until we made him stop. He was patient as Larkin learned to walk after him and pat him, sometimes a little too hard, and pull his tail. He would lay under Layne's crib when I nursed her or while we played in her room.
Knowing he is no longer uncomfortable doesn't make it any easier to say goodbye. He has been my puppy for 11 years, and I can't believe he is gone.
We will miss you, Joey. You were a good boy. Thank you for your unconditional love.
